Our Daily Bread Food Pantry is an ecumenical food pantry servicing the Greater Danbury community. Its mission is to help those in need of food, whatever their circumstances, and maintain the dignity of clients in a compassionate and caring atmosphere. Our Daily Bread offers one bag of groceries per month.

Daily Bread is located on Terrace Place, in the rear building of St. James' Episcopal Church at 25 West Street, Danbury, CT.  Bring quarters for the meters when you join us! Contact Peggy Zamore ([email protected]to join our team.

Prepare for the High Holy Days

From the Rabbi ....   The High Holy Days will be here soon! In fact, Elul, the Hebrew month that precedes Rosh Hashanah, begins this Sunday.  During Elul, Jews have traditionally set aside part of each day to study and prepare for the High Holy Days (HHD's). This custom allowed Jewish people to encounter and grapple with the themes of the HHD's well before they ever arrived for services. Read more ...
